WebEvolution P a g e 1 LAB#23: Biochemical Evidence of Evolution Name: Period _____ Date : Laboratory Experience #23 Worth 80 Lab Minutes Bridge If two organisms have … WebAnother type of evidence for evolution is the presence of structures in organisms that share the same basic form. For example, the bones in the appendages of a human, dog, bird, and whale all share the same overall construction (Figure 2) resulting from their origin in the appendages of a common ancestor. Over time, evolution led to changes in ...

The fossil record reveals how horses evolved. The lineage that led to modern horses (Equus) grew taller over time (from the 0.4 m Hyracotherium in early Eocene to the 1.6 m Equus).
